Unfortunately, yes, the incentive of monetization has resulted in a decrease of quality discussion.

Contrast, for example, the number of comments and upvotes for your post.

At the time of my writing, you have:
126 Comments
39 Upvotes

With almost all comments agreeing with your assessment.

So either people are commenting on your post without upvoting, even though they agree.
For these people, a comment is financially incentivised.

Or you are being equally downvoted. Perhaps you could share the statistics, as it would be interesting :).

Compare this with most any other subforum, where discussion, even if shitposting, has an inverse relationship (more upvotes than comments per post), because there is no financial incentive.

Would you say moons encourage cryptocurrency to be more mainstream here, or are they reinforcing an echo chamber of people who would already be engaged in the cryptocurrency space?

It definitely increases the quantity of posts but not quality. Someone who is going to make a well thought out post isn't going to just not do it because they won't get paid.

It can also cause some people to be afraid to speak "controversial" opinions. Some people will either stay quiet so as to not get downvotes/be associated with views that lead to not getting upvotes on non related posts later. This then leads to group think.

Honestly it was terrible about a year ago. The change that reduced people's earnings if they sold helped a lot though, as it seemed to shut up the people who just posted shit to get money out straight away.
